Avatar
おもちさんの言うように「アンラップしたいなら評価時に!をつける」で統一された世界も安全でいいと思います let vv = v! type(of: vv) // __ObjC.UIView.Type switch v!.isHidden { // これもコンパイル通る case true: () case false: () }